What is Automated Multi-Channel Communication?

It means using technology to send the right message, to the right customer, at the right time, through their preferred channel. Think appointment reminders, service follow-ups, and promotional offers. This is the future of automated customer communication for auto repair.

Why Automate?

Manual communication is time-consuming and prone to errors. Automation frees up your staff to focus on what they do best: fixing cars and providing excellent service. It ensures consistent messaging and a professional customer experience.

Step 2: Choose Your Auto Repair Shop Customer Engagement Software

This is a critical decision. You need a platform that integrates with your existing Shop Management System (SMS).

Here are a few to consider:

  • AutoVitals: Often praised for its comprehensive suite of tools specifically designed for the automotive industry. They offer robust multi-channel marketing for auto shops with features like automated text and email campaigns, appointment reminders, and digital inspection reports.

  • ProDemand (Mitchell 1): While known for its diagnostic and repair information, ProDemand also offers customer management and communication tools that can be integrated. It's a strong contender for shops already invested in the Mitchell 1 ecosystem.

  • Shop-Ware: This is a modern, cloud-based SMS with built-in communication features. It allows for email and text reminders and aims to streamline shop operations, including customer outreach.

Step 3: Define Your Communication Channels

Customers prefer different ways to be contacted. You should aim to be present on the most effective channels for your clientele.

  • Text Messaging (SMS): Excellent for urgent messages like appointment reminders and quick service updates. It has a high open rate.
  • Email: Ideal for more detailed information, service history summaries, and marketing promotions.
  • Phone Calls: Still important for complex issues or personalized follow-ups. Automation can assist with initial calls or voicemails.
  • Social Media: Engaging customers on platforms like Facebook can build community and promote offers.

Step 4: Map Out Your Customer Journey & Automations

Think about every touchpoint a customer has with your shop, from booking an appointment to post-service follow-up.

  • Pre-Appointment:
    • Appointment confirmation (text/email).
    • Reminder 24-48 hours before (text/email).
    • Directions or parking information (email).
  • During Service:
    • "We've received your vehicle" notification (text).
    • Digital inspection report with photos/videos (email/portal).
    • "Service is complete" notification (text/email).
  • Post-Service:
    • Thank you note and request for review (email/text).
    • Service interval reminders (email/text).
    • Promotional offers for future services (email).

Step 6: Monitor and Optimize

Automation isn't a "set it and forget it" solution.

  • Track key metrics: open rates, click-through rates, response times, and conversion rates.
  • Gather customer feedback on your communication methods.
  • Adjust your messages, timing, and channels based on performance.
